One point is better than none

On paper we should have won this game. We needed to bounce back after our abysmal performance at Villa last Sunday. The scene was set for us to do that with a home game against struggling Wolves. Yet it was an even, slightly scrappy game. Both sides had a number of good opportunities to score. It was goalless at half-time but we went ahead in the 50th minute with a great scissor kick from Ben Mee. Unfortunately, two minutes late they equalised and the game finished 1-1. Annoyingly, Ivan Toney was booked so he misses our next game away to Nottingham Forest (I feel this is a must win game for us). It is now up to our summer sightings to step up to the mark (yet they didn’t seem to do that against Wolves when they came on as subs).
